Stuffed Jalapeno Peppers
Recipe By : Serving Size : 8 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: Appetizers 2 Points Per Serving
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- 12 large jalapeno chili peppers 1/2 teaspoon cumin seed 1/2 cup nonfat cream cheese -- at room temperature 3 ounces sharp cheddar cheese -- grated 2 tablespoons dry bread crumbs -- plain 1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
Preheat oven to 425º. Line baking sheet with foil; spray foil with nonstick cooking spray. In small nonstick skillet, toast reserved jalapeno seeds and cumin seeds over medium -low heat, stirring constantly, 2-5 minutes, until fragrant and golden; transfer to small bowl. Add cream and cheddar cheeses to toasted seeds; with fork, mash mixture together until well blended. Stuff each pepper half with an equal amount of cheese mixture; set aside. On small plate, combine bread crumbs and oregano. dip filled side of each pepper into bread crumb mixture; set on prepared baking sheet, crumb-side up. Bake 10 minutes, until lightly browned; serve immediately.
